Taberei nr. 2, 145200, Tr. Măgurele – TeleormanBiotransformation is the chemical modification (or modifications) made by an organism on achemical compound. If this modification ends in mineral compounds like CO 2 , NH + 4 or H 2 O,the biotransformation is called mineralisation. Biotransformation means chemical alterationof chemicals such as not limited to amino-acids, toxins, drugs in the body render nonpolarcompounds polar they’re not reabsorbed in renal tubules. Drug metabolism is example of abiotransformation typically the body deals with a foreign compound by making it moresoluble, to increase the rate of its excretion; there are a number of different process that canoccur; the pathways of drug metabolism can be divided into I st , II nd phases. Phase I reactionincludes oxidative, reductive and hydrolytic reactions a polar group is either introduced orunmasked, so the drug molecule becomes more water-soluble and can be excreted. Reactionsare non-synthetic in generally produce water soluble, active metabolites of metabolites aregenerated by hydroxylating Cytochrome P450. Phase II reaction involve covalent attachmentof small polar endogenous molecule such as glucuronic acid, sulfate, or glycine to formwater-soluble compounds as a conjugation reaction final compounds have a larger molecularweight.
